This activity returns a UiElement variable that contains the position where the text was found. If this does not work for you, then manual intervention might be required. The target can also be automatically generated by using the Indicate on Screen functionality, which tries to identify UI elements in the indicated region, and generates selectors for them. As input, this activity receives a string which contains the text to be searched for, and a Target, which can be either a Region variable, a UiElement variable or a selector, that helps you identify what you want to automate and where the actions must be performed. This activity can be useful in locating UI elements relative to text on the screen. This activity returns a string variable containing the text found in the UI element, and a TextInfo variable that contains the screen coordinates of all the found words.įind OCR Text Position searches for a given string in an UI element, and returns a UIElement variable which contains the said string. As input, this activity receives a Target, which can be either a Region variable, a UiElement variable or a selector, that helps you identify what you want to automate and where the actions must be performed. There are some differences between these OCR engines, as explained here, making them fit for different situations. By default, the Google OCR engine is used, but you can easily change it with Abbyy or Microsoft. This activity can also be automatically generated when performing screen scraping, along with a container. Get OCR Text extracts a string and its information from an indicated UI element using the OCR screen scraping method. As input, these activities receive a Target, which can be either a string variable, a Region variable, a UIElement variable or a selector, which indicate the coordinates where the action must be performed. These are very useful activities in automating basic actions in virtual machine environments. If graphic elements change, but the text does not, automations created using text recognition will usually still work. □Ī best practice in creating automations is using the Recording Wizard to create the project, automatically generating selectors, and then tweaking the activities to best fit your needs.ĭouble Click OCR Text, Click OCR Text and Hover OCR Text use OCR to scan the screen of the machine for text and perform actions relative to it. Citrix and other remote desktop utilities are usually the target of OCR-based activities, as they only stream an image of the desktop to the user, which means normal UI selectors are impossible to find. This enables the user to create automations based on what can be seen on the screen, simplifying automation in virtual machine environments. Activities in UiPath Studio which use OCR technology scan the entire screen of the machine, finding all the characters that are displayed. In some situations, certain applications are not compatible with the usage of normal scraping or UI automation technologies.
